  • Patent number: 4945669
    Abstract: A jig fishing lure characterized by a controlled rate of descent in water comprising: a barbed fishing hook with a molded plastic head (e.g., polyethylene, polypropylene and/or copolyester) with an internal metal core (e.g., lead) and trailing skirt. By selecting the relative amounts of plastic and metal core used in the head of the jig, the overall fall rate of the lure in water can be controlled from about 2 feet per second to about 1 foot per 3.25 seconds. Knowing the controlled fall rate, the fisherman can select and control the depth of the jigging action during fishing.
